Where can I get a visa for Tanzania?

Generally, everyone entering Tanzanian territory must have a tourist visa, the price is $100 for U.S. passport holders, US$75 for Canadians, and $50 for EU and most other passport holders. The best idea is to obtain the visa from the Tanzanian Embassy at your country of origin.

Tanzania Electronic Visa Application System

You can now apply for an Online Visa to visit the United Republic of Tanzania both Tanzania Mainland and Zanzibar You are required to fill in the online form, make payment, and submit your application online. Your form will be internally reviewed and processed.
Applicants will be notified through their e-mails whether their applications have been accepted or rejected. They may also Track their application statuses through the online system. Applicants may as well be required to visit the nearest Tanzanian Embassies or Consular Offices for interviews.
Applicants of Visa are strongly advised to read carefully the Visa Guideline before making an application.
Visa applicants are advised to make their applications through the Official Tanzania Immigration website Only and Not through any other links;
Any applicant of Visa is assumed to have read, understood and agreed to the terms and conditions stipulated in the Disclaimer and Visa Guideline ;
Applicants must ensure that their passports have a validity of at least six months and at least one unused visa page before submitting their application
Applicant is expected to apply for a right category of visa. If the applicant is not sure about the type of visa he/she requires, he/she is advised to seek guidance through the e-mail info@immigration.go.tz
Any visa wrongly applied or which lacks sufficient attachment may be rejected.
No refund will be made in respect of any rejected visa application.
The Visa applications will be processed within ten days, therefore applicants are strongly advised to observe the stipulated time frame while making their applications;
After making payments, applicants are required to wait for approval of their Visa before they start their journey. Approval notification will be sent to their e-mail. Or they can access the Visa Grant Notification by checking the Status of their Visa online;
The Tanzania Immigration Services Department may give or withhold reasons for rejection of Visa to the applicant.
Applicants whose nationals fall under Referral Visa category are not advised to book flight tickets or make payments for any reservations in Tanzania before they get approval for their Visa. Applicants of Referral Visa are advised to apply at least two months before their date of travel;
The list of countries which fall under Referred Visa may change at any time; therefore, applicants are advised to review our website from time to time.
Visa regulations and conditions may be subject to change at any time without prior notification to the applicants.

What are the types of visa valid for entry into Tanzania?

Ordinary Visa (Single Entry Visa)
This visa is granted to foreign national for the purposes of Visit, Tourism, Leisure, Holiday, attending Conference, Humanitarian and charity activities, Family Visit, Health Treatment or any other purpose as may be determined by the issuing authority. Its validity does not exceed 90 days for a single entry.

Business Visa
Business visa may be issued for a period not exceeding 90 days to foreign nationals who wish to enter in the United Republic of Tanzania for one of the following Purposes,To conduct special assignments such as fixing/repairing machines or to run short term training, etc.
To conduct short time professional roles such as auditing accounts, making feasibility studies, establishing professionals and business contacts, making arrangements for investments during the startup period etc.To conduct any other short term lawful business-related task recognised by the laws of the country and as may be determined by the issuing authority.

Multiple Entry Visa
This Visa may be issued to foreign nationals whose purposes of visits call for frequent visits to the United Republic of Tanzania. These may include Directors of Companies registered in Tanzania who do not reside in the country, Persons engaged in Bilateral Meetings, Spouses married to Tanzanians/Residents, Government Consultants, Representatives of international NGO’s and any other person as may be determined by the Commissioner General of Immigration or Commissioner of Immigration Zanzibar.
This Visa (Multiple) is also issued to American citizens who wish to come for Holiday or Tourism purposes, as they are not entitled for Ordinary Visa. The maximum validity of this Visa is 12 months. However, the holder of the Multiple Visa cannot stay in the country for twelve (12) consecutive months. They are required to leave the country at most after every three months.

Transit Visa
This Visa may be issued to foreign nationals for the purpose of transiting through to another destination outside the United Republic for a period not exceeding seven days. The applicant of this visa may be required to provide proof of a Visa of the destination country and/or onward ticket.
